Banji and his schoolkids took to the BGT stage on Saturday night after King Charles was officially crowned as monarch at Westminster Abbey.

A Britain's got Talent act dedicated their performance as a special tribute to the newly crowned King Charles III.

"We hope to win and perform in front of the new King, King Charles III," one of the kids said as they beamed towards the crowds erupting with clapping. Audiences were delighted as they burst into song with their catchy and upbeat performance which involved them dancing and singing across the stage in a musical-style number with Union Jack umbrellas out in full force.After their performance, Simon said: "Sometimes when we see these school acts no one is smiling but this was the opposite."If King Charles III was sat up in the box he would have absolutely loved it," added Amanda.

"That's EXACTLY the school I would like to be at," before they got a resounding 'yes' from the judges and went through to the next round.
